Romania - Export of Badminton or Similar Rackets
Since 2014, Romania Export of Badminton or Similar Rackets jumped by 65.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 45 among other countries in Export of Badminton or Similar Rackets with $61,628.71. Romania is overtaken by Saudi Arabia, which was ranked number 44 with $65,057.88 and is followed by Israel at $45,008. China lead the ranking with $235,696,859.67 in 2019, that is an increase of 2.5% compared to 2018. Japan, Singapore and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Georgia witnessed the best average annual growth at +173.7% per year, while Fiji witnessed the worst performance at -87.7% per year.
